To prepare the Peach Cobbler first, peel the peaches, cut into small pieces and cook over high heat, bringing them to boil, with half the sugar and lemon juice, turning them often until they are soft.

2
Zatheka

Payokha, prepare the dough for the cobbler.
Mu mbale yaikulu, mix the flour, shuga, baking powder and salt. Add the milk and stir to mix the dough which must however remain semi-liquid consistency.

3
Zatheka

Melt the butter in an oven dish, and pour the mixture into the pan without stirring.

4
Zatheka

Pour the peaches over the dough, again without stirring. Sprinkle as desired with a little cinnamon powder.

5
Zatheka

Heat the oven to 180 ° C and bake your cobbler for about 40-45 minutes or in any case until it is golden brown.
Your Peach Cobbler is ready! You can serve it both warm and cold.
Try it also with vanilla ice cream!

This dessert is perfect for summer evenings with friends. The original recipe includes the use of peaches, but nothing detracts from being able to use other seasonal fruit at your leisure, such as apricots!
